What a great result for Zimbabwe. Even though it was an under strength Indian team any team that wears the Indian jersey is always going to have some great players. It was great to see all the batsmen score runs, although Lamb still didn't look comfortable. Lamb however not throw his wicket away and toughed it out. What a great debut for Craig Ervine - he looks like a class performer. Just imagine if we could get Sean Williams back also. Ervine and Williams would make for a strong middle order.

Lets hope we capitalise on this good start and dont fade away like we have in our last few series.
